BRIEF: Woman charged with DUI in fatal crash on Lake Shore Drive
Chicago Tribune (IL)
March 16--A woman has been charged with misdemeanor driving under the influence after a fatal two-car crash on Lake Shore Drive, police said.
About 1:15 a.m. on March 10, a northbound car made make a left turn onto Balbo Drive and crashed into another car that was southbound on Lake Shore Drive, police said.
The northbound car flipped over, injuring people.
The driver of the car, Chyna Bell, 29, was taken in serious condition to Northwestern Memorial Hospital, where her blood alcohol content was recorded at .08.
A 28-year-old passenger was taken in critical condition to Stroger Hospital, and another man, 27, was pronounced dead at Northwestern, police said.
The driver of the second vehicle refused medical help at the scene.
Bell, of the 7500 block of South Kingston Avenue, was charged with misdemeanor DUI. She was also cited for driving a vehicle with no insurance and making an improper left turn, police said.
Bell was scheduled to appear April 25 in traffic court.
